Cut it down, either dig up root or drill holes down in the leftover root and pour root killer into the holes (someone told me diesel is good for this).
If you cant cut it down, you can still drill holes into it (at a downward angle) and pour root killer into it, takes longer and could fall over one day.

Drill a hole big enough to fit a piece of copper pipe (10mm or 13mm) about 4" long at an angle of say 35-40 deg, tap the piece of pipe into the hole and then fill the pipe with brake fluid. Top the pipe up every now and then. The copper pipe will kill the tree and the brake fluid will speed the process up :y
